1. Mod chips accomplish the same thing as a firmware flash, except that they *might* be a little more safe. I say "might" only because no one but Microsoft knows for sure.
2. I can only tell you that from what I've read you're much safer if you follow a STRICT rule of only playing backups offline. And by "offline" I don't mean "not in multiplayer mode" - I mean signed out of Xbox Live and with your ethernet cable unplugged (just to make sure). Most people seem to believe that that's the only safe way to play backups without being banned.
3. See #2. The general consensus is that if you stay completely off of XBL while playing a backup game (I don't even keep one in the tray while connected) then you're pretty safe. But to answer your question, yes, you can get online once you've flashed/chipped. Just don't play backups online or, if I might add, play backup games even in single-player while signed in to Live.
nothing is 100% safe. If you're looking for absolutes, there are none when it comes to modding your 360 and staying on XBL.
